Enum Logger.LogLevel

    • Enum Constant Detail

      • DEBUG

        public static final Logger.LogLevel DEBUG
        More detailed logging level.
      • TRACE

        public static final Logger.LogLevel TRACE
        Most detailed logging level.
    • Method Detail

      • values

        public static Logger.LogLevel[] values()
        Returns an array containing the constants of this enum type, in the order they are declared. This method may be used to iterate over the constants as follows:
        for (Logger.LogLevel c : Logger.LogLevel.values())
            System.out.println(c);
        
        Returns:
        an array containing the constants of this enum type, in the order they are declared
      • valueOf

        public static Logger.LogLevel valueOf​(String name)
        Returns the enum constant of this type with the specified name. The string must match exactly an identifier used to declare an enum constant in this type. (Extraneous whitespace characters are not permitted.)
        Parameters:
        name - the name of the enum constant to be returned.
        Returns:
        the enum constant with the specified name
        Throws:
        IllegalArgumentException - if this enum type has no constant with the specified name
        NullPointerException - if the argument is null
      • shouldLog

        public boolean shouldLog​(Logger.LogLevel logLevel)
        Whether the message at given logLevel should be logged.

        For example, if current logging level is DEBUG, the method will return true for logging at INFO, but false for logging at TRACE.

        Parameters:
        logLevel - log level of the message
        Returns:
        true if current log level is considered detailed enough for the passed logLevel to log the message, false otherwise
